Cast iron radiators

This type of water heater, familiar to us from childhood, is still used to this day, despite the emergence of many modern competitors whose technical characteristics are much better. This is due to several reasons, for example, the high corrosion resistance of cast iron and the ability to work in systems with high coolant pressure. In addition, for many people, tribute to tradition is important and, despite any explanations, they are still convinced that cast iron batteries are the best.

This opinion has a basis, since these devices are very reliable and durable; according to these criteria, they have no equal, since they last from 30 to 50 years. In addition, cast iron heaters retain heat for a long time, having great massiveness and inertia. This advantage is also a disadvantage: cast iron batteries take a long time to heat up and take just as long to cool down, so it is very difficult to organize automatic climate control in the room where such devices are installed.

If previously the appearance of cast iron batteries left much to be desired, now many companies offer cast iron heating radiators with various powder coatings or decorative casting.

True, this improvement has taken traditionally cheap heaters out of the budget category, since such products are much more expensive. Their other disadvantages are well known: large weight and water capacity, although recently these have been reduced to a minimum.

What’s good about cast iron batteries is that they can be installed everywhere: in an apartment, house, or cottage. But it is best to use them for heating a private house where a gravity system is organized. It itself is inertial and has a large volume of coolant flowing at a low speed. This is exactly what a massive cast iron appliance needs.

Steel batteries

This type of heaters is divided into two types

  • panel;
  • tubular.

Panel radiators are good radiators for a private home, where the operating pressure of the coolant does not exceed 3 Bar. The fact is that their design and manufacturing technology provide for operation in a system with a maximum pressure of up to 15 Bar. This is often not enough in conditions of centralized heating, especially in high-rise buildings.

The panels have good heat transfer, relatively light weight and size, and are also distinguished by their aesthetic appearance. There are also steel radiators with bottom connections, which makes it possible to install them in apartments with individual heating and piping hidden in the floor.

In addition, among all heating devices, steel panels have the lowest cost, so they often remain the only acceptable option. Disadvantages include sensitivity to corrosion and a relatively short service life (up to 15 years).

When you need to install a steel radiator in a central heating system, it is better to choose a tubular type device that has thick, massive walls that can withstand high pressure and water hammer. Therefore, such batteries can be installed anywhere, they are reliable and durable.

Another thing is that the cost of tubular devices is quite high, and there are disadvantages similar to cast iron batteries: inertia, large capacity and considerable weight. Because of this, they are rarely installed in country houses and other buildings with an individual heating system, preferring the same heaters made of cast iron or aluminum.

Aluminum radiators

One of the most popular heating devices - sectional aluminum batteries - are distinguished by the best degree of heat transfer, fast heating and cooling, low weight and remarkable appearance.

All these advantages are realized thanks to the device body made of aluminum alloy. It contains vertical channels with a cross-section close to circular, and on the outside these ducts are equipped with many ribs that intensively transfer the energy of the coolant to the air in the room. In turn, the flat surfaces of the aluminum battery produce a uniform flow of radiant heat. The physical properties of aluminum make it possible to organize automatic control of heating power, since inertia in this case is practically absent. A small capacity (up to 0.25 liters of water in each section) also contributes to rapid heating.

Aluminum radiators for the home are easy to assemble and install due to their simple design and low weight of the products. They can be attached to any building structures, even plasterboard partitions. You just need to correctly calculate the required number of sections for heating the room; sales representatives or online consultants of online stores will always help you with this.

As for the shortcomings, there are only two. The first is similar to steel panels: a low threshold for maximum operating pressure (up to 16 Bar), which makes the installation of aluminum batteries in centralized heating systems risky. The second is ordinary and electrochemical corrosion of the alloy due to exposure to low-quality coolant from central heating networks. Therefore, aluminum ones are the best radiators for any individual heating systems, where the quality of the coolant is controlled by the homeowner himself, and the pressure in the system is controlled by the boiler automation. But in apartments with central heating it is better to install bimetal.

Bimetallic radiators

In fact, bimetallic batteries are the same products made of aluminum, inside of which there is a welded frame made of steel pipes with thick walls. As a result of this modernization, the shortcomings associated with the quality of the coolant and its pressure were successfully eliminated.

At the same time, the heaters have slightly less heat output than purely aluminum ones, but much more than those of steel or cast iron appliances. Therefore, in the case of centralized heat supply systems for heating, it is better to install bimetal radiators; they will serve for a long time and reliably, while releasing heat much more intensely than other types of devices. But it should be said that the cost of bimetallic batteries is significantly higher than aluminum ones.

Features of centralized heating systems

Scheme of central heating in apartment buildings.

Heating a multi-storey building requires the construction of a large boiler room, where a powerful gas boiler is installed. From here, thick pipes are sent to the house, through which the coolant moves. And the higher the multi-story building, the higher the pressure of the coolant, since it needs to rise to a greater height and pass through hundreds of radiators, overcoming high hydraulic resistance.

As for multi-storey buildings with individual apartment heating, they are much less common. This is how houses with a height of 3-5 floors are built, where it is more profitable to create several autonomous heating systems than to build and maintain a common boiler room - this requires additional funds and additional human resources to maintain boiler equipment. But the pressure in autonomous systems is much lower - the batteries will be relatively safe.

As you may already understand, the main enemy of heating batteries in apartment buildings with a centralized heating system is high coolant pressure. Due to this, batteries often begin to leak, or even burst, when exposed to pressure from water. Subsequent repairs result not only in replacing the batteries themselves, but also in a complete renovation of the apartment (sometimes not your own, but the neighbor’s).

It must be remembered that the higher the building, the higher the pressure in the pipes. The highest rate is in modern buildings up to 20-26 floors (and higher).

Centralized heating systems also pose other dangers:

Water hammer instantly increases the pressure in the heating system and not all radiators can withstand it.

  • Water hammer - they occur as a result of pressure changes. If boiler room employees open the coolant supply too abruptly, or shut it off just as abruptly, then the pipes and heating radiators in the houses will suffer a powerful blow. And many radiators, for example, aluminum ones, may not withstand such exposure and burst, flooding rooms and household items with hot water;
  • Low quality coolant is another factor that negatively affects not only pipes, but also radiators. It often contains quite active chemical components that spoil the metal. Corrosion is also affected by fine mechanical impurities of various origins - they have no less negative effects on radiators and pipes;
  • Temperature changes - it cannot be said that they have a direct effect on heating equipment, but as the temperature rises, the pressure also increases. Therefore, some batteries simply cannot stand it and burst, since they are not designed for such temperature loads.

Resistant to high pressure and water hammer

The best heating batteries for an apartment are those that can withstand high pressure. The higher the house, the higher the maximum possible pressure in the battery should be. You also need to remember about possible water hammer, so this figure is doubled. If we consider that the pressure in the heating systems of high-rise buildings reaches 15-16 atmospheres, then the batteries must withstand a maximum pressure of up to 32 atmospheres.

Corrosion resistance

Many radiator models are susceptible to corrosion. Electrical corrosion, which can occur at the junction of different metals, is especially dangerous.

Far from pure water flows in the pipes of heating systems. There are also quite aggressive components used to clean pipes and radiators from traces of corrosion. Along with rust and scale, aggressive components also eat through metal. And if the same cast iron can still boast of durability, then aluminum is subject to destruction under such influence. Mechanical impurities require the use of thick-walled metal that is resistant to mechanical stress.

Bimetallic radiators

If you don’t know which heating radiators are best to install in an apartment, then we recommend that you turn your attention to bimetallic models. Inside them we will find:

  • Steel base - it can withstand pressure up to 50 atmospheres and resists corrosion well;
  • The aluminum body, which is not in contact with the coolant, provides simply excellent heat transfer.

Bimetallic radiators are not afraid of water hammer and high pressure; they are easy to install and dismantle. They are also resistant to high temperatures and are lightweight, and thanks to the presence of effective corrosion protection, they can boast a long service life. Exactly bimetallic radiators are the best for installation in apartments, be it a small three-story building or a solid 26-story building.

Despite many advantages, bimetallic batteries have one disadvantage - their high cost. Therefore, the costs of purchasing them will be quite significant.

Power is an important characteristic

Depending on the type of room where the heating radiator will be installed, you will have to make some calculations. It is necessary to determine in advance the required power of heating radiators so that you do not have to freeze in the room later.

Different types of radiators have different capacities. The radiator power characteristic is a value that determines the heat transfer efficiency of each of its sections. So, one battery section has a power (W):

    cast iron - 80–150,

    aluminum - 190,

    bimetallic - 200,

    steel (entire radiator) - 450–5700.

When making calculations, we must not forget about important points: wall thickness, room size, number and type of windows, etc. It is believed that in a standard apartment room with one window and a door, it is enough to install a radiator with a power of 90–125 W per 1 square meter.

    10% if the window faces north;

    20% if the radiator is hidden under a solid decorative panel;

    30% if the room is corner and has two windows.

The “safety margin” characteristics should also be added to the power category. This indicator determines the radiator’s ability to withstand the maximum coolant pressure. For cast iron it is 10–15 atm, for aluminum 16 atm, bimetal can withstand 35 atm, and steel only 6–8 atm.

Painting for beauty and protection

After the most careful installation of system elements, chips and scratches still form on the surface of the radiator. In other cases, batteries are repainted to refresh the paint or to change the color.

It is important to understand that not all paint can be applied to radiators. The most suitable paint for heating radiators should, firstly, be heat-resistant. It must withstand temperatures up to 100 degrees, keep up with the metal and not change color.

There are special paints for heating radiators; they are durable and protect the metal well. Paints containing metal powder (bronze, aluminum) also have good heat resistance.
